‘Ensure tariff relief is sustained over time’

Listen to article


KARACHI:

Leading businessmen, while appreciating Prime Minister Shehbaz Sharif’s announcement of a substantial reduction of Rs7.59 per unit in electricity tariffs for industrial consumers and Rs7.41 per unit for domestic consumers, have stated that it is a critical move that will ease financial pressure on both businesses and citizens, who have long struggled with exorbitant tariffs.

In a joint statement, Businessmen Group Chairman Zubair Motiwala, Karachi Chamber of Commerce and Industry (KCCI) President Jawed Bilwani and other senior leaders emphasised that the relief package came at a time when it was needed the most.

They called the initiative a “historic intervention” and a bold step towards providing relief to millions of households and thousands of businesses across the country. “This tariff reduction would have far-reaching positive effects, which will not only ease the financial burden on consumers but also revitalise the industrial sector, fostering economic growth, enhancing exports, and contributing to a more competitive business environment,” they said.

“It is an essential catalyst for the growth of local industries. Over the years, high energy costs have hindered industrial productivity, and this reduction will bring tangible benefits to manufacturing and exports, which are the key drivers of economy,” Motiwala remarked.

KCCI President Bilwani stressed the need to ensure that the tariff relief was sustained over time. “This announcement is a step in the right direction. However, it is essential for the government to continue working closely with the business community to monitor energy pricing and ensure long-term tariff stability for both industries and households,” he said.

Echoing similar views, Federal B Area Association of Trade and Industry President Shaikh Muhammad Tehseen termed the reduction in industrial electricity tariff a business-friendly step.
